The RED method: A new strategy for monitoring microservices

Monitoring an application is crucial for providing a quality product and experience for users. But simply collecting a ton of application metrics doesn’t solve the true problem. What software companies need is a way to get actionable insights from their metrics so they can quickly fix any issues their users are experiencing.

Enter the RED method.

[ Also on InfoWorld: Why you should use a microservice architecture ]

RED method origins

The RED method is a monitoring methodology coined by Tom Wilkie based on what he learned while working at Google. RED is derived from some best practices established at Google known as the “Four Golden Signals,” developed by Google’s SRE team.
